commit c4f8555b6a8085a6a5b3c18a8a21e8aab51fe6d9
Author: Albert Astals Cid <[email protected]>
Date:   Sun Jan 5 01:20:37 2020 +0100

    Make getUnicodeMap param a const & instead a const *
    
    Now you can write globalParams->getUnicodeMap("UTF-8")
    which makes much more sense
